The best attributes of the Eclipse are:
Ease of trailering - set up and launch under your own timetable going wherever you want to explore.
No cost storage in your own back yard.
Your maintenance cost will be lower while on the trailer in your garage or yard.
The boat is an excellent sailing craft; a light, responsive and balanced tiller feels like my former 27 foot fin keel sloop.
The combination of the shoal draft fixed keel and the centerboard, combined with kick up rudder allow exploration of shallow water, and excellent up wind tracking as well.
The large, cockpit seats four adults and is easily accessible via the open transom and boarding ladder after a swim. The well-designed cabin interior maximizes usable space for storage, sitting out bad weather, using the head, or heating up a meal on the stove.

Specifications:
LOA 20' 10" LOD 18' 5" LWL 18' 1" Beam 7' 4" Draft (board up) 1' 6" Draft (board down) 5' 2" Disp 2,200 lbs. Ballast 700 lbs. Sail Area 200 Sq. ft. Mast height above water line 26' 0"
